                  But will the shoes actually be properly shaped? That was one of the most annoying ever on 2k13, shoes in the game are all shaped alike, as opposed to being shaped like they are in real life. Basically we had hi/mid/low-top bases, but they were just skinned to look like the shoes. But in most cases, it didnt look right at all. I'd love to see that fixed.
